Just a Gray Day
Pearl shrouds from the heavens
Riding fast
Storms are brewing a winter’s blast
Winds nipping at your back
Cutting through everything with a crack
Sleet on my widows tapping away
No site of the sun today
Natures reminding all
Of her order of things
More time to wait
Till the spring birds sing
Gloomy and dim
Behind a hidden limb
Shaking and bracing
A sparrow so grim
Cover up
Take a sip
Of a cup
Have some coffee or tea
Banish into a book
A romantic novel with plea
Feel the comfort inside
Where you sit and hide
From the day
Today
So gray
